Hardware Component Architecture
Redundant and robust tests have been conducted on DELL’s PowerEdge servers to determine best
practices and guidelines for building a balanced FTDW system.
Figure 1. Proposed Dell Fast Track Reference Architecture
Configuration availability may be further enhanced by configuring database clustering using multiple
servers.
Table 1. Tested Dell Fast Track Reference Architecture Component Details
Component
Details
Server
PowerEdge R510 (BIOS: 1.6.3)
CPU
(1) Intel® Xeon® CPU X5675 @3.07GHz (HT Enabled)
Number of cores per socket 6
Total Number of CPU Cores 6
Memory
48GB RAM (3 * 16 DDR3 DIMMs @1066MHz)
Internal Hard Drives
12 x 600GB 15K RPM Serial-Attach SCSI 6Gbps 3.5in Hotplug Hard Drive
Operating System
Microsoft Windows® 2008 R2 SP1 Enterprise Edition
Database Software
Microsoft SQL Server 2008 R2 Enterprise Edition
